This PR introduces the overloaded
DirichletBCtype and its corresponding PyAdjoint block (DirichletBCBlock) to dolfinx-adjoint. This enables the tracing and optimization of boundary conditions that depend on control parameters, such as time-varying boundary values or boundary control problems.Key Changes:
Added
DirichletBCoverload (src/dolfinx_adjoint/types/dirichletbc.py): Wraps dolfinx.fem.DirichletBC as a FloatingType and eagerly annotates it to the working tape.Added
DirichletBCBlock(src/dolfinx_adjoint/blocks/dirichletbc.py): A PyAdjoint block that registers the underlying FEniCSx Function or Constant as a dependency and handles the forward recomputation.In-place Tape Replay (
src/dolfinx_adjoint/blocks/function_assigner.py): Updated FunctionAssignBlock to update the FEniCSx function arrays in-place during recompute_component().Solver Dependency Tracking (
src/dolfinx_adjoint/blocks/solvers.py): Updated LinearProblemBlock to correctly detect and register dependencies from provided boundary conditions.Testing (
tests/test_dirichlet_bc.py): Added test coverage for tape recording, the annotate=False bypass, block recomputations, and a full time-dependent PDE tape replay.
